Aruba Quality Apartments & Suites – Smart, Spacious, and Convenient in Oranjestad
If you’re searching for a stay in Aruba that balances comfort, convenience, and value — rather than resort-level extravagance — Aruba Quality Apartments & Suites delivers. This property offers roomy, fully equipped apartments, a relaxed vibe, and a location that gives you easy access to beaches and island attractions without the high prices of beach-front resorts.
It’s ideal for travelers, families or couples who want flexibility and practicality over resort glamour.
Why Aruba Quality Apartments & Suites Works for You
Aruba Quality Apartments & Suites stands out because it gives you “home-away-from-home” comfort. Instead of cramped hotel rooms, you get spacious studios or suites with kitchen facilities, which makes it easier to cook, relax, and stretch out. This is especially useful if you plan a longer stay or want to save money on meals.
Moreover, the property offers useful amenities like an outdoor pool, free parking, laundry facilities, and free WiFi. That mix of features + value makes it especially attractive for guests who want a functional base while exploring the island.
Rooms & Amenities – Comfortable, Practical, and Guest-Ready
Here’s what you’ll find at Quality Apartments & Suites:
-
Fully-equipped kitchen or kitchenette — fridge, stovetop or microwave, cookware, etc. Great for breakfasts, snacks, or full meals.
-
Spacious, air-conditioned rooms and suites — more room than a typical hotel room, ideal for couples, friends or families.
-
Outdoor pool and pool-side lounging area — nice for relaxing after beach or sightseeing days.
-
Free parking and laundry facilities — very useful if you rent a car or stay for multiple days.
-
Free WiFi and reliable amenities — including TV, safe, and room comforts that make it feel like an apartment, not a cramped hotel.
This setup makes the stay practical — and comfortable — without overpaying.
Location – Easy Access, Close to Beaches & Essentials
Located on Schotlandstraat in Oranjestad, the property is a short drive from some of Aruba’s top beaches, including the popular Palm-Eagle Beach area
That means you can enjoy beach days, nightlife, or island exploring — then return to a calm, comfortable apartment for rest. For travelers who rent a car (like many of your clients), this balance of convenience and quiet is especially appealing.

Aruba is one of the Caribbean’s most visitor-friendly destinations. The island has excellent infrastructure — well-maintained roads, reliable utilities, fast internet and a highly professional tourism industry. English is widely spoken across the island alongside Dutch, Papiamento and Spanish. Crime rates are very low and the island consistently ranks as one of the safest Caribbean destinations. The currency is the Aruban Florin (AWF) but US dollars are accepted universally. Queen Beatrix International Airport handles flights from across North America, Europe and South America, making Aruba easily accessible. The island is small enough to explore fully in a week — just 33km long and 10km wide — but has enough variety in beaches, activities and food to keep visitors busy for two weeks or more.
